Overview of the Wine
Winegrowing is a passion that has been passed down from father to son in the Humbrecht family since the 17th century. Domaine Zind Humbrecht today comprises of 40 hectares of vines, spread out over an array of different terroirs in the geological patchwork which is the Alsatian wine region and birthplace of our noble grape varieties.

The expression of terroir, conveyed through grape varieties of Alsace, is reinforced by cultivating the vines organically and according to biodynamic principles. Great lengths are gone to each growing season to produce the best quality grapes from each vineyard. As respect for the vine and soil life is imperative, the viticultural tasks are carried out by a team of 22 dedicated staff members. The high ratio of vineyard worker to vineyard surface enables an attention to detail and the execution of many of the viticultural tasks manually. In addition, animal traction and the use of their own compost help to reduce the impact of mechanical compaction on the soils.

Ripe, balanced and concentrated grapes enables the elimination of any vinification techniques that would modify the initial harmony of each terroir. Fermentations are very slow, and the wines spend a minimum of 6 months on the total lees. The wines are bottled between 12 and 24 months after the harvest.

"For a few years now, this wine is produced exclusively from one little parcel of vineyard located a stone throw away from the Goldert vineyard in Gueberschwihr. Proximity doesn’t of course mean identical! There is some Oolithic limestone present in the soil, but also a fair amount of sandstone and marl. The soil is more fertile and deeper, which accentuate the late ripening character. The Gewurztraminer grape grows slowly, keeps great acidity and doesn’t suffer from draught or excessive heat. Very healthy grapes produced a wine that fermented very dry, in an unusual style from this vineyard."

Organic and biodynamic viticulture: since 1997, Organic certification 1998 by Ecocert, biodynamic certification by Biodyvin / Ecocert in 2002.

Winemaker's Tasting Notes
The nose exhibits already today beautiful honeyed, botrytised aromas. The nose feels almost as rich as an SGN, showing lots of candied fruits, apricots, quince as well as the classic Jebsal minerality. The palate is unctuous and sweet, not cloying, as there is lots of acidity there to make the finish harmonious. This is great late harvest style, able to rival the best vintages

93 Points - Wine Enthusiast
Zind-Humbrecht’s 2006 Pinot Gris Clos Jebsal Vendange Tardive smells headily of nearly over-ripe musk melon, peach, and apricot, then surprises on a dense palate with surprising firmness and an extraordinary, vivid retention of fresh pit fruit and citrus acids that virtually electrify what follows. A confitured marzipan and caramel wave appears, mingling somehow serendipitously with the streams of fresh fruit, while subtle fruit pit bitterness adds counterpoint in a vibrant yet decadently rich finish. This could serve as an unusually versatile, true dessert wine, given its combination of vivid fresh fruit acid with huge (yet not in the least too much) sugar. I was thinking apricot tart, “but how about rhubarb?” suggests Humbrecht. Indeed. It should also be worth cellaring for 15-20 years. 

92 Points - Vinous
(14% alcohol, 114 g/l r.s.) Bright gold. High-toned, rot-ennobled aromas of apricot, quince and honey. Almost painfully sweet in the mouth, but with firm acidity, exhilarated botrytis tones and underlying minerality giving shape and grip to the superripe flavors of quince jelly, mirabelle and marzipan. Finishes very long and supersweet, with a strong cherry-almond element and surprising freshness. This was picked at near-SGN must weight, with impeccable honeyed botrytis.
